| TEST_CASE("The URL class can parse various URL strings", "[URL][parsing]") { |
| const auto canParseURL = [](const std::string& url_string) { return minifi::http::URL{url_string}.toString() == url_string; }; |
| |
| REQUIRE(canParseURL("http://nifi.io")); |
| REQUIRE(canParseURL("http://nifi.io:777")); |
| REQUIRE(canParseURL("http://nifi.io/nifi")); |
| REQUIRE(canParseURL("https://nifi.somewhere.far.away:321/nifi")); |
| REQUIRE(canParseURL("http://nifi.io?what_is_love")); |
| REQUIRE(canParseURL("http://nifi.io:123?what_is_love")); |
| REQUIRE(canParseURL("https://nifi.io/nifi_path?what_is_love")); |
| REQUIRE(canParseURL("http://nifi.io:4321/nifi_path?what_is_love")); |
| REQUIRE(canParseURL("http://nifi.io#anchors_aweigh")); |
| REQUIRE(canParseURL("https://nifi.io:123#anchors_aweigh")); |
| REQUIRE(canParseURL("http://nifi.io/nifi_path#anchors_aweigh")); |
| REQUIRE(canParseURL("https://nifi.io:4321/nifi_path#anchors_aweigh")); |
| } |
| |
| TEST_CASE("The URL class will fail to parse invalid URL strings", "[URL][parsing]") { |
| const auto failToParseURL = [](const std::string& url_string) { return minifi::http::URL{url_string}.toString() == "INVALID"; }; |
| |
| REQUIRE(failToParseURL("mailto:santa.claus@north.pole.org")); |
| REQUIRE(failToParseURL("http:nifi.io")); |
| REQUIRE(failToParseURL("http://")); |
| REQUIRE(failToParseURL("http://:123")); |
| REQUIRE(failToParseURL("http://nifi.io:0x50")); |
| REQUIRE(failToParseURL("http://nifi.io:port_number")); |
| } |
| |
| TEST_CASE("The URL class can extract the port from URL strings", "[URL][port]") { |
| REQUIRE(minifi::http::URL{"http://nifi.io"}.port() == 80); |
| REQUIRE(minifi::http::URL{"http://nifi.io/nifi"}.port() == 80); |
| REQUIRE(minifi::http::URL{"https://nifi.io"}.port() == 443); |
| REQUIRE(minifi::http::URL{"https://nifi.io/nifi"}.port() == 443); |
| REQUIRE(minifi::http::URL{"http://nifi.io:123"}.port() == 123); |
| REQUIRE(minifi::http::URL{"http://nifi.io:123/nifi"}.port() == 123); |
| REQUIRE(minifi::http::URL{"https://nifi.io:456"}.port() == 456); |
| REQUIRE(minifi::http::URL{"https://nifi.io:456/nifi"}.port() == 456); |
| } |
